'Bonnie,' 'Jim' couple well for ABC

Morning Ratings Flash - Rick Kissell

ABC is gaining momentum on Tuesday nights, as the return of "According to Jim" and the move of "Life With Bonnie" to its new timeslot lifted the net to a first-place finish in adults 18-49 (4.9/13), according to prelim nationals from Nielsen. CBS remained on top in total viewers, boosted by the season preem of "Judging Amy" (15.4 million).

ABC's "Bonnie" (prelim 11.3 million, 4.8/12 in A18-49) and the premiering "Less Than Perfect" at 9:30 (10.6m, 4.4/11) held up well opposite NBC's combo of "Frasier" (14.4m, 5.6/14) and "Hidden Hills" (11.2m, 5.0/12). Both of NBC's laffers were way down from the previous week, when "Frasier" opened its season with a wedding between Niles and Daphne.

ABC's "8 Simple Rules" (5.2/15 in 18-49) and "According to Jim" (5.1/14) took advantage of no competing Fox comedies (net aired baseball) to dominate the 8 o'clock hour in all key demos.

NBC again did OK with new laffer "In-Laws," which placed second in 18-49 with a 3.4/10 in adults 18-49 at 8 and a 4.0/11 at 8:30.
